Our Proven 3-Step Method

From first move to tournament-ready — here's how we get there.

🎯

Meet & Assess

Your child's free 20–30 min trial lesson. You're welcome to watch the whole thing. Your coach assesses their level and puts together a personalized learning plan — before the second class even starts.

♟️

Build the Foundation

One-on-one lessons first. We move fast — covering the most important topics in an accelerated format — and bring your child up to a solid level at their own pace.

🏆

Play & Compete

Once the foundation is in place, your child starts playing against a partner. Real games, real decisions — the final step toward tournament play.

Class Prices

Flexible lesson lengths. No expiry on your package.

⏱️

30 minutes

$15/ class

8 classes — $120

Most Popular

45 minutes

$20/ class

8 classes — $160

🏆

60 minutes

$25/ class

8 classes — $200

Minimum package of 8 classes. Your package never expires — and if you forget and miss a class without prior notice, it won't be deducted. It stays available for you. 😊

Risk-Free Guarantee

Not happy after your first paid lessons? We'll refund the rest of your package — no questions asked. Your child's progress and your peace of mind come first.
